charms.mongodb.v1.mongodb_backups

# Copyright 2023 Canonical Ltd.
# See LICENSE file for licensing details.

"""In this class, we manage backup configurations and actions.

Specifically backups are handled with Percona Backup MongoDB (pbm).
A user for PBM is created when MongoDB is first started during the start phase.
This user is named "backup".
"""
